COE Historical Earnings Data (2013–2024)
12 years| Fiscal Year | Net Income | YoY % | Operating Income | EPS (Diluted) | Net Margin | Op. Margin |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| -$7M | +51.9% | -$8M | $-72.00 | -14.3% | -15.9% |
| 2023 | -$15M | +64.7% | -$14M | $-144.00 | -55.4% | -50.4% |
| 2022 | -$43M | -327.1% | -$12M | $-468.00 | -282.8% | -82.1% |
| 2021 | $19M | -11.8% | -$5M | $175.20 | 2377.9% | -582.7% |
| 2020 | $21M | +242.3% | $16M | $237.00 | 6.8% | 5.1% |
| 2019 | -$15M | +75.4% | -$15M | $0.00 | -7.1% | -7.3% |
| 2018 | -$61M | +31.9% | -$59M | $0.00 | -36.4% | -35.3% |
| 2017 | -$89M | -20.0% | -$87M | $0.00 | -68.5% | -67.3% |
| 2016 | -$74M | -47.1% | -$74M | $0.00 | -123.1% | -122.4% |
| 2015 | -$50M | -207.3% | -$50M | $0.00 | -211.5% | -208.1% |
